Queen Elizabeth II
Cecil Beaton
Gelatin silver print
Buckingham Palace
1968
Museum no. PH.1963-1987
Beaton's assistant, Geoffrey Sawyer, suggested some photographs be taken outside. Beaton noted in his diary: 'The electricians were installed with enough equipment to light an entire film unit. I gave instructions for alternative 'sets' in case the initial scene did not materialise and Geoff suggested the balcony might be good. I found a splendid Acropolis-like corner with three columns.'
